Be prepared to spend a little time here... 3/14/2011

I'm a comic dork, and I love this place!\r Possibly the largest selection of new titles, graphic novels and art books in the entire Atlanta area.\r Although a bit light on toys, they always have plenty of collectible statues and mini-busts for sale, and their items are rarely jacked up in price.\r My only complaint is that the staff is not always enthusiastic - while I've never had a truly bad experience I have had more than enough lackluster ones. But I've always received an hoinest answer to my questions and been pointed in the right direction when necessary.\r If you've got a little extra time to kill, it's worth the drive to spend a while browsing through the many many items available. more

One of the classics 5/20/2009

Like Oxford, one of the Atlanta comic fixtures. Not really close to me anymore, but worth a trip just to browse the graphic novel wall. I never fail to find something new just poking around. The only reason they don't get 4 stars is that the people who work there are inconsistent.. If you see Cliff, he's brilliant! Your odds are 60/40 otherwise - 60% good, 40% not so great. Gives the place character, but sometimes I just want to know when something is coming out. Pros: Comic selection is huge, graphic novel selection is huge more

Great selection of unfriendly employees 5/11/2009

Without belaboring the point, Dr. No's has consistantly provided the worst customer-service I have ever seen in a comic shop. I'll drop by every couple of years to give them another chance, and each time they continue to disappoint. The only thing keeping this from being a 1star review is the fact that they're a good place to get hard-to-find items. Whether or not you're willing/able to pay for them is another matter. Pros: Large layout, lots of gaming supplies and room to play Cons: The employees more
